PowerPoint Is Evil: "Imagine a widely used and expensive prescription drug that promised to make us beautiful but didn't. Instead the drug had frequent, serious side effects: It induced stupidity, turned everyone into bores, wasted time, and degraded the quality and credibility of communication. These side effects would rightly lead to a worldwide product recall." Not if it's PowerPoint. Edward Tufte offers some insights. There's also an excellent short piece, Learning to Love PowerPoint, by David Byrne. From Wired.
